Cost

If you don't have the money to cut the keys to your car, this can be an issue. It's expensive to buy the blank keys and it is even more expensive to cut them by a locksmith or dealer. Fortunately, there are some things to keep in mind to help cut down the cost of purchasing the new key.

The nature of the key is the first aspect that determines the cost. Keys that are older are typically less costly than replacement of the latest keys. The type of material that is used to create keys also has an impact on its price. Some manufacturers use high-quality materials that add to the total cost of the key.

The cost of programming a specific type of key is another aspect. Modern keys contain transponders that must be programmed to function with the vehicle's specific system. These chips are more difficult to duplicate, and are typically only sold to automobile dealers and locksmiths.

It is crucial to compare prices before selecting a company to program the spare car key cutting near me key. Online retailers can offer aftermarket or factory replacement keys for less than what you'd pay to your dealer. Find out if they offer the programming services your vehicle needs.

AutoZone stores usually provide key duplication services. However this process is more involved than just cutting the blade. This can take up to an hour, so it's recommended to go to a dealer to complete the process.

In addition to having the key cut and programmed people also need the fob or remote that a car comes with. The electronic device can control the engine as well as lock and unlock the doors, as well as keep track of the location of your vehicle.

Key fobs cost between $50 and $100. It can be programmed by a locksmith or dealer. Some dealers can do this at no cost, while others might charge for a half-hour or an hour of labor.

Typically car owners can select from two distinct types of car key duplication services that are traditional cut or laser cut. Traditional cut keys have a basic design on the edge of their blades. They can be made by any locksmith. This type of key is easily found, making it a popular choice for a lot of people.

This type of key is also a security risk due to its small combination spread and is easy to identify. This is why it's essential to hire an experienced locksmith for this job. These professionals can not only create a new key for your car, but can also decode your ignition cylinder. This is a difficult procedure, but it can help you save money over time.

Laser cut keys are designed to be more secure from theft. They are thicker and feature the same groove both sides like regular car keys. This will prevent thieves from hot-wiring your car. Laser cut keys are also more durable than traditional car keys. They are also easier to identify which makes it more difficult for criminals to steal them.
